Boulder, Colorado
This home has a warm, welcoming vibe. A guest described it best "the home gives you a hug" when you walk through the doors. Built in 1901, this Victorian Painted Lady Farmhouse sits on the corner of the entrance to Newlands Neighborhood west of Broadway. It is rumored that the house was once occupied by Crosby, Stills, Nash and Young in the 1970's. If you listen hard enough.....
This house sits on 1/3 of an acre with a fantastic yard for a BBQ and lawn games! The upstairs has 3 bedrooms and a full bathroom. There is also a full bath downstairs. There is a "hangout room" with a TV upstairs as well as 2 additional TV's on the lower level. You will have full use of the house and yard. The house has a new central AC. I have a couple of touring bikes and one hybrid that may be used. You will be just 3 blocks from a City Recreation center with an indoor pool and hot tub. There are also outdoor tennis and pickleball courts.
3 Bears House is only a few blocks from the foothills of the Rockies, so you can start hiking out the front door.
